Understanding Peptides
Peptides are naturally occurring molecules made up of amino acids. These building blocks are essential for proteins and play a crucial role in several biological activities within the body. For instance, certain peptides can help with healing, anti-aging, and even weight management. From a mental and emotional perspective, understanding this can be empowering. When we know that our bodies have innate mechanisms that can be supported, it sets a foundation for self-improvement and mental clarity.
The Science Behind Peptide Therapy
Peptide therapy aims to utilize these natural compounds to stimulate specific biological functions. For example, some peptides can promote muscle growth or increase hormone levels, making them appealing for anyone looking to enhance physical performance. However, anyone considering peptide therapy should be aware of both benefits and potential side effects.

There are several ongoing debates regarding peptide therapy that experts continue to explore:
1. Efficacy and Safety: One common question is whether peptide therapy is genuinely effective for its claimed benefits. Experts often analyze its safety and efficacy based on limited clinical data, which varies widely in quality.
2. Regulation and Quality Control: The regulation of peptide products presents another crucial discussion. As companies increasingly capitalize on the popularity of peptides, the lack of consistent oversight raises concerns.
3. Long-term effects: The long-term effects of peptide therapy are still unclear. Researchers are exploring whether prolonged use yields significant benefits or if potential adverse effects arise.
Each of these open questions highlights the importance of ongoing research within the field, encouraging individuals to learn and seek knowledge rather than jump to conclusions.
